Wintrust is a financial holding company with approximately $50 billion assets under management and traded on the NASDAQ:WTFC. Built on the "HAVE IT ALL" model, Wintrust offers sophisticated technology and resources of a large bank while focusing on providing service-based community banking to each and every customer. Wintrust operates fifteen community bank subsidiaries with over 170 banking locations in the greater Chicago and southern Wisconsin market areas. Additionally, Wintrust operates various non-bank business units including commercial and life insurance premium financing, short-term accounts receivable financing, out-sourced administrative services, mortgage origination and purchase, wealth management services and qualified intermediary services for tax-deferred exchanges.

Position Overview

This position will join our growing Cloud and Application Security team with a focus on SaaS and API security. The Security Engineer will functionally support multiple teams in securing the company's SaaS products portfolio and API inventory.  This role provides the opportunity to also gain exposure and experience with other programs in Security Engineering such as Application Security, Vulnerability Management, and Penetration Testing activities.  To be successful in this role, candidates should have experience in complex, fast-paced, technical environments with a passion for technology and process-driven, collaborative problem solving.

What You’ll Do


  • Coordinate with business units to develop SaaS posture standards and drive compliance through monitoring and alerting.


  • Analyze data from SaaS applications to create relevant and appropriate threat alerts.


  • Proactively monitor for SaaS integration risks and Shadow SaaS to reduce risk landscape across the Enterprise.


  • Analyze APIs for security risks and coordinate with development teams in remediation.


  • Provide guidance and knowledge on security best practices for SaaS configuration and secure API development in alignment with Wintrust policies and industry standards.


  • Assist Application Security with Dynamic Code scanning


Qualifications


  • 3-5 years general experience in information security - operations, engineering, incident response, SOC analyst, application security, etc


  • Cybersecurity or related industry certifications (e.g., CISSP, CISM, CCSP, CISA).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Security, or a related field is a plus, but not required.


  • Experience in auditing SaaS application configurations for security vulnerabilities and compliance gaps


  • Familiarity with security frameworks and standards relevant to SaaS environments


  • Experience with API security or implementation. Threat modeling, software development, or cloud security experience is a plus.
